Made for demanding, off-road landscapes, mountain bikes are all about durability and impact and are well-equipped for downhills, forest trails, single tracks and unpaved areas. MTBs often have knobbly tyres for grip and traction in poor conditions, but optimal tyre types will vary based on the surface you’re riding on. From lightweight singlespeeds to cruisers to e-bikes, almost every kind of bike can be found in a folding version. Additionally, some of the folding bikes we’ve selected are designed to be one-size-fits-all, and that may result in a less-tailored fit compared to a regular bike. However, many folding bikes have adjustable components, such as the seat post, stem angle, and handlebars to improve fit and comfort.
